Abstract

Brain perfusion SPECT imaging has been applied to patients with dementia using 123I-IMP and 99mTc-HM-PAO. Brain blood flow closely parallels regional brain metabolism or brain function with normal cerebrovascular function. Therefore neuronal activity can be indirectly evaluated by in vivo brain perfusion imaging in dementia. This nuclear medicine technique is quite useful for the differential diagnosis, assessment of the degree and localization of the affected area, disease course, and therapeutic effect. IMP seems to be superior to HM-PAO in detecting focal decreased perfusion and quantitative analysis. Hereafter the brain perfusion SPECT study will be more widespread. Neuroreceptor imaging is highly expected as the next step of a brain SPECT study.
